🔧 Prompt Settings Breakdown

Looking at these settings, here's what makes this image work so well for "Golden Hour Elegance on a Cliffside Terrace." Each parameter plays a crucial role in creating a captivating portrait that feels both relaxed and luxurious.

Lighting

The lighting is designed to evoke a romantic and warm mood through the use of natural daylight during the golden hour. This soft, warm light enhances skin tones and creates a flattering glow. The backlit direction from a low angle adds depth, making the subject's hair and shoulders shimmer with rim lighting. If you adjust the light to a harsher source, the image may lose its warmth and feel less inviting.

Background

The background is slightly blurred, which draws attention to the woman while still providing context. The cliffside terrace setting, with its lush greenery and blue sea, enhances the upscale Mediterranean vibe. If you were to switch to a busier background, it could distract from the main subject. Keeping the background elements soft helps maintain focus on the woman.

Composition

Centering the subject using a medium close-up shot helps create an intimate feel. The eye-level perspective makes it relatable. Adjusting the framing to a wider shot might lose some of that connection, while a tighter crop could feel too claustrophobic. Aim for a shallow depth of field to keep the focus sharp on the subject, which is particularly effective in portrait-style images.

Color Profile

The vibrant, warm color palette enhances the overall elegance of the image, with warm golden tones contrasting beautifully against deep blues. If you increase saturation too much, colors may appear unnatural. Instead, maintain a balance to keep the image inviting.

Practical Tips

    1. Utilize golden hour: This time of day provides the best natural light for portraits.
    2. Experiment with angles: A low angle can add drama and highlight features.
    3. Be mindful of background: Keep it simple to avoid distraction.
    4. Adjust depth of field: A shallow focus will help your subject stand out.

Common mistakes include using harsh lighting or cluttered backgrounds. For variations, consider adjusting the time of day for different moods, or try different clothing styles to change the image's vibe. 💡 Image Generation Tips

This image succeeds because it effectively combines composition and lighting to create a stunning visual narrative. The low angle image composition enhances the subject's prominence against the expansive backdrop, drawing viewers' eyes upward and creating a sense of grandeur. During golden hour, the soft, diffused light bathes the scene in warm hues, which is a fundamental aspect of golden hour photography tutorials. This light not only enhances colors but also adds depth and texture to the image, making it more inviting.

Success Factors

Key factors contributing to the success of this portrait include:

    1. Composition: The use of the rule of thirds positions the subject in a way that balances the scene.
    2. Lighting: The warm tones of golden hour create an ethereal quality that elevates the overall mood.

    Implementation

    To replicate this success, consider these technical highlights:

    1. Use a low angle: Position your camera slightly below eye level. This perspective creates a more dynamic and engaging composition.
    2. Timing is key: Shoot during the golden hour, approximately one hour before sunset. This ensures optimal lighting conditions.
    3. Experiment with AI image generators: Use this tool to visualize different lighting scenarios before shooting.

Actionable Guidance

For similar projects, plan your shoot around the golden hour and scout locations that offer cliffside terraces or elevated perspectives. Ensure you have a clear vision of your composition to avoid clutter.

Common Failure Patterns

Many creators overlook the importance of lighting, resulting in flat images. To prevent this, always prioritize the golden hour and test your camera settings beforehand.
